> the HTTP Service Jetty embedds a jetty server but does not export the api of jetty itself. So it is impossible to use e.g. Jetty GZIP filter without embedding another version of jetty.
> To improve this, the bundle can exporrt tje jetty bundles and import them with resolution=optional so it would even be possible to provide a never/patched jetty version to the bundle.
